GUS-QS8B-01-4222-GF Description
GUS-QS8B-01-4222-GF Description
The GUS-QS8B-01-4222-GF from TT Electronics/IRC is a high-performance thin-film resistor network designed for precision applications. This 16-pin QSOP (Quarter Small Outline Package) device integrates 15 resistors with a 42.2KΩ resistance value, offering a 2% tolerance and a ±100ppm/°C temperature coefficient. With a 0.75W (3/4W) total power rating (0.05W per resistor), it operates reliably across a wide temperature range of 70°C to 125°C, making it suitable for demanding environments. The gull-wing termination and surface-mount design ensure easy PCB integration, while the compact dimensions (4.9mm x 6.02mm x 1.47mm) save board space.
